Surfers around the world covet boards by savvy Australian craftsman Hayden Cox.

- By BENNETT RING

Asurfboard that not long ago spent several weeks being shaped in the Sydney factory of Haydenshap­es is now carving through eightfoot waves off the coast of Hawaii. As one of the world’s most in-demand surfboard manufactur­ers, Haydenshap­es has grown from just a handful of staff to 30 in-house employees and another 200 distributi­ng and manufactur­ing these artworks of wave-shredding beauty.

The entreprene­ur behind these surf boards is Hayden Cox. He learned the art of shaping boards while working in Sydney at age 15. From there, he dedicated his life to creating premium surfboards, which now sell from about US$675 to nearly US$4,000 for the top-ofthe-line models. Famous customers include Rob Trujillo of Metallica and actor brothers Chris and Liam Hemsworth.

“Surf boards are all about creating a good experience for surfers,” says Cox, “and you can’t fake that part.” To fulfil that promise, Cox created his proprietar­y FutureFlex technology that th hat dispenses with the central wooden w stringer of a convention­al design de and introduces a parabolic carbon ca rail concept, which delivers a ap particular flex and feel in the ride. It also makes these boards take off much m faster when catching a swell.

Haydenshap­es’ Hypto Krypto m model has been the company’s be bestseller for the past three years an and has been named surfboard of th the year twice in Australia and last ye year in the US. There’s no end of nu nuance to the shape, the curve of th the rails and the concave underside that all determine the board’s performanc­e and maneuverab­ility. Hypto Krypto is also hailed for its versatilit­y across variable wave conditions and its suitabilit­y for beginners through to highly experience­d riders.

Going global has hurt many bespoke surfboard makers, as the challenge of maintainin­g the close relationsh­ip between maker and customer disintegra­tes w with distance. While Cox’s staff w works hard to counter that, H Haydenshap­es relies extensivel­y on its website to allow potential bu buyers to design the board they w want, using the HSStudio custom bo board-design digital program. “The de detail in shape, the ways you are ab able to customise your order from di dimensions to artwork and the fin configurat­ion — it’s the most ad advanced online custom boardor ordering platform in the industry,” sa says Cox.

His adherence to quality co control combined with his passion an and expertise have led him to be become one of the most admired su surf board makers in the world. haydenshap­es.com ha
